The concept of "Hal Varian net worth" serves as a proxy for the immense value society places on his expertise. In an era where data is often called the new oil, Varian was one of the first economists to articulate how to refine and utilize that resource. His work on two sided markets—platforms that connect distinct user groups such as buyers and sellers—provided the intellectual framework for understanding the gig economy, app stores, and social media networks. He has consistently argued that regulation should focus on outcomes and competition rather than targeting specific technologies, a perspective that has guided policymakers and corporations alike. While he stepped back from his day to day role at Google around 2020, moving to a position as Emeritus Professor at Berkeley and Senior Vice President at Alphabet, his intellectual footprint remains deeply embedded in the company’s strategic DNA. His continued engagement through writing, speaking, and advising ensures that his influence persists, making him not just a wealthy economist, but a pivotal architect of the modern digital world whose ideas will continue to shape markets for decades to come.
